Regional Elections and Their Implications for Economic Sentiment
This chapter explores the implications of Poland's presidential election on both domestic unity and regional market attractiveness, while reflecting on South Korea's shift towards progressive leadership and its potential effects on international relations. It highlights cautious optimism for economic opportunities related to North Korea that could reshape investment prospects in the region.
